Output 590314bc8c843147aa8ff216ff3e7dff6c18e91b08e62cb60d197d8849acc2e2:0

value
24840
script pubkey
OP_0 OP_PUSHBYTES_20 c02aa6cdc2e5d4dcd85b4450c9c7404ac393f546
address
bc1qcq42dnwzuh2dekzmg3gvn36qftpe8a2x3k9fnu
transaction
590314bc8c843147aa8ff216ff3e7dff6c18e91b08e62cb60d197d8849acc2e2
confirmations
166394
spent
true